Buckwheat Cooked in Water
Ingredients
- 1 cup Buckwheat Choose high-quality buckwheat without any impurities.
- 2 cups Water Should be clean and odorless.
- 1 tsp Salt Add to taste.
- 1 tbsp Oil You can use either olive or sunflower oil.
Method
- Rinse the buckwheat thoroughly under cold water to remove dust and impurities.
- In a pot, bring water to a boil and add salt.
- Once the water is boiling, add the buckwheat and reduce the heat to low.
- Cover the pot and cook the buckwheat for 15-20 minutes until done.
- Turn off the heat and let the buckwheat stand covered for another 10 minutes.
- Before serving, add the oil and gently mix.
